The R2000-TP operates by emitting radio waves and receiving signals from RFID tags within its reading range. Upon receiving the signals, it decodes the data and transmits it to the connected system for further processing. The adjustable power output and multi-tag reading capabilities enhance its efficiency in capturing RFID tag data.
The R2000-TP can be deployed in warehouses and distribution centers for real-time inventory tracking, reducing manual efforts and improving accuracy.
In corporate environments, the reader can be integrated into access control systems to provide secure and efficient entry management for employees and visitors.
Industries such as logistics and manufacturing benefit from the long-range reading capability of the R2000-TP, enabling precise tracking of assets across large facilities.
